sanzaru
A stateless, lightweight MCP server that wraps OpenAI's Sora Video API, Whisper, GPT-4o Audio, and TTS APIs via the OpenAI Python SDK.
Features
Video Generation (Sora)
- Create videos with
sora-2orsora-2-promodels - Use reference images to guide generation
- Remix and refine existing videos
- Download variants (video, thumbnail, spritesheet)
Image Generation
- Generate images with gpt-image-2 (recommended), gpt-image-1.5, or GPT-5
- Edit and compose images with up to 16 inputs
- Iterative refinement via Responses API
- Automatic resizing for Sora compatibility
Audio Processing
- Transcription: Whisper and GPT-4o models
- Audio Chat: Interactive analysis with GPT-4o
- Text-to-Speech: Multi-voice TTS generation
- Processing: Format conversion, compression, file management
Podcast Generation
- Multi-voice podcasts with up to 4 speakers and 10 TTS voices
- Parallel segment generation with configurable pacing
- MP3/WAV output with loudness normalization
Note: Content guardrails are enforced by OpenAI. This server does not run local moderation.
Requirements
- Python 3.10+
OPENAI_API_KEYenvironment variable
Media storage (choose one):
# Recommended: unified path (auto-creates videos/, images/, audio/ subdirs)
SANZARU_MEDIA_PATH="/path/to/media"
# Or individual paths (legacy, still supported)
VIDEO_PATH="/path/to/videos"
IMAGE_PATH="/path/to/images"
AUDIO_PATH="/path/to/audio"
Features are auto-detected based on configured paths. Set only what you need.

Manual Setup
uv venv
uv sync
# Set required environment variables
export OPENAI_API_KEY=sk-...
export SANZARU_MEDIA_PATH=~/sanzaru-media
# Run server (stdio for MCP clients)
uv run sanzaru
# Or HTTP mode (for remote access)
uv run sanzaru --transport http --port 8000

Basic Workflows
Generate a Video
# Create video from text
video = create_video(
prompt="A serene mountain landscape at sunrise",
model="sora-2",
seconds="8",
size="1280x720"
)
# Poll for completion
status = get_video_status(video.id)
# Download when ready
download_video(video.id, filename="mountain_sunrise.mp4")
Generate with Reference Image
# 1. Generate reference image (gpt-image-2, synchronous)
generate_image(
prompt="futuristic pilot in mech cockpit",
size="1536x1024",
filename="pilot.png"
)
# 2. Prepare for video (resize to Sora dimensions)
prepare_reference_image("pilot.png", "1280x720", resize_mode="crop")
# 3. Animate
video = create_video(
prompt="The pilot looks up and smiles",
size="1280x720",
input_reference_filename="pilot_1280x720.png"
)
Audio Transcription
# List available audio files
files = list_audio_files(format="mp3")
# Transcribe
result = transcribe_audio("interview.mp3")
# Or analyze with GPT-4o
analysis = chat_with_audio(
"meeting.mp3",
user_prompt="Summarize key decisions and action items"
)
Generate a Podcast
generate_podcast(script={
"title": "AI Weekly",
"speakers": [
{"id": "host", "name": "Alex", "voice": "nova"},
{"id": "guest", "name": "Sam", "voice": "echo"}
],
"segments": [
{"speaker": "host", "text": "Welcome to AI Weekly!"},
{"speaker": "guest", "text": "Thanks for having me."}
]
})

Transport Modes
| Mode | Command | Use Case |
|---|---|---|
| stdio (default) | uv run sanzaru |
Claude Desktop, Claude Code, local MCP clients |
| HTTP | uv run sanzaru --transport http |
Remote access, Databricks Apps, web clients |
Storage Backends
| Backend | Config | Use Case |
|---|---|---|
| Local (default) | SANZARU_MEDIA_PATH=/path/to/media |
Development, local deployments |
| Databricks | STORAGE_BACKEND=databricks |
Databricks Apps with Unity Catalog Volumes |
The Databricks backend supports per-user storage isolation via the user_context module, enabling multi-tenant deployments where each user's media is stored under their own volume prefix.
